Fime Sinamai Renger is a 1978 Iranian feature film from the pre-revolution era, directed by Ahmad Moradpour and written by Behzad Behzadpour. It stands as a preserved piece of classical Persian cinema, offering a window into the storytelling sensibilities and visual language of late Pahlavi-era filmmaking.

Context & significance

Iranian cinema of the late 1970s occupies a unique and emotionally charged place in the cultural memory of the diaspora. Films produced in this period captured everyday Iranian life — its music, manners, humor, and drama — before the 1979 revolution fundamentally transformed the country's cultural landscape. For Iranians living abroad, titles from this era carry deep nostalgic resonance, offering a connection to the Iran of parents and grandparents. Renger belongs to this precious archive of pre-revolution Persian cinema, the kind of film that diaspora audiences seek out specifically because it preserves a world that no longer exists in the same form.
